基于人工鱼和细胞膜优化医学DR图像增强研究

Research of Medical DR Image Enhancement Based on Artificial Fish Swarm and Cell Membrane Optimization

  • 摘要: 针对医学DR图像对比度低、细节和边缘不清晰的问题,提出一种基于人工鱼和细胞膜优化的医学DR图像增强方法。该方法采用人工鱼群算法优化Otsu方法,利用优化后的Otsu方法对医学DR图像进行分割,采用细胞膜优化算法对分割后的部分区域分解,分解后的高频强区做非线性增强,高频弱区和低频区做直方图均衡化增强,其余部分做线性增强。仿真实验表明这种方法有效地消除了医学DR图像中噪声,增强后医学DR图像细节信息更加清楚,具有高的有效性和鲁棒性。

     

    Abstract: According to the problem that details of medical DR image are buried,edge of image is vague,contrast of image is reduced.Method of medical DR image enhancement based on artificial fish swarm and cell membrane optimization is proposed.Otsu method is optimized by artificial fish swarm algorithm.Medical DR image is divided by optimized Otsu method.Divided some area is decomposed to high frequency strong area,high frequency week area and low frequency area by cell membrane optimization algorithm.High frequency strong area is treated with nonlinear enhancement,high frequency weak area and low frequency area are treated with histogram equalization enhancement,other area is treated with linear enhancement.Simulation experiment on this method shows that noise of medical DR image is eliminated,details of medical DR image is more clear,effectiveness and robustness with this method are both high.
